Abstract

Studying and extracting information from random, non-linear, and unstable signals such as electrical brain signals, is considered a very important research task, especially if we can achieve early detection of brain lesions (such as tumors and inflammatory abscesses). Therefore, in this research, we presented a simple method for processing electrical brain signals (EEG). So that we can help doctors read the EEG and give a preliminary diagnosis of the patient’s condition, in addition to determine the type and location of the brain lesion based on (frequency_ correlation) analysis of the brain’s electrical signals.The (frequency _ correlation) method was used for the brain's electrical signals after extracting its characteristic coefficients by using wavelet transform. We compared the results with the (time- -correlation) method, and the accuracy of results compared with other diagnostic methods reached 90%.
